#49 Unless I misunderstood what you were talking about, the dungeons with bosses from other FF titles are completely optional. So if you can't defeat those bosses, you can still beat the game normally without going through those dungeons. |

| | 1. Sorcerer. Reason should be obvious. Cheapness. 2. Frost Dragons in the ToFR. It's not much fun being repeatedly obliterated within 2 minutes of walking in the door. 3. Anything that poisons you, just because of the annoyance factor of re-ordering your party in the NES version. And the annoyance of running out of antidotes in the Marsh Cave, when you're still poor enough that buying PUREs can be troublesome. 4. Ankylos. If I'm going to kill a walking tank, give me some gold for it. How can you hate Warmech? He should be admired.
Yes, nothing uses CONF in FF1. |
